The Influence of School Principal Leadership Immediately with Congregational Spirituality for Strengthening The Character of Teachers and Students Dasrimin, Henderikus

Abstract

This research aims to describe the implementation of school principal leadership that is imbued with the spirituality of religious congregations in an effort to strengthen the character of teachers and students. The research method used is a qualitative descriptive approach. The research design used a multi-site study, which was carried out in three Catholic Junior High Schools (in Indonesian it is abbreviated: SMPK), in Malang City, Indonesia. The three schools are SMPK Mardi Wiyata Malang, SMPK Santa Maria 2 Malang, and SMPK Sang Timur Malang. The results of the research show that the implementation of school principal leadership that is imbued with congregational spirituality is developed through a spirituality of a loving heart, a spirituality of the heart that upholds human honor and dignity, and a spirituality of a caring heart. The application of spiritual leadership can have a positive impact on the personal formation of teachers and employees as well as strengthening the character of students.
PENGARUH MEDIA PAPAN LABIRIN TERHADAP HASIL BELAJAR SISWA PADA MATA PELAJARAN MATEMATIKA MATERI PENJUMLAHAN BERSUSUN KELAS I SDI KOTA UNENG Cahyani, Nur; Rininelda Dua, Marsela; Dasrimin, Henderikus

Abstract

Learning media play an important role in creating meaningful mathematics learning experiences for elementary school students. The use of appropriate instructional media is expected to improve students' understanding and learning outcomes, particularly in the topic of vertical addition. One learning medium that can support this process is the maze board. The objectives were to determine students' mathematics learning outcomes before and after the implementation of the maze board learning media and to analyze its effect on learning outcomes in the topic of vertical addition for first-grade students at SDI Kota Uneng. A quantitative approach was employed using a Pre-Experimental Design with the One Group Pretest–Posttest Design. The sample consisted of 28 first-grade students selected through saturated sampling. Data were collected through tests, observations, and documentation. Data analysis included descriptive statistics, the Shapiro–Wilk normality test, and the Paired Sample t-test. The findings indicated that the average pretest score of 60 increased to 75 on the posttest, while learning mastery improved from 42.86% to 75.00%. The hypothesis test produced a significance value (Sig. 2-tailed) of 0.000 (<0.05), indicating that the use of the maze board learning media had a significant positive effect on students' mathematics learning outcomes in the topic of vertical addition.
